Description
Technical Field
The utility model relates to a lathe machining auxiliary fixtures technical field specifically is a circle PIN needle concatenation clamping tool.
Background
The lathe is a machine tool for turning a rotating workpiece by mainly using a lathe tool, corresponding processing can be performed on the lathe by using a drill bit, a reamer, a screw tap, a die, a knurling tool and the like, the stability of the lathe for clamping the processed workpiece is an important factor influencing the processing of the lathe, and aiming at a columnar product of a fine round PIN (5) shown in the attached drawing 1, the columnar product cannot be directly clamped and fixed on the lathe, so that a special clamping jig needs to be designed for processing.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
Specific example 1: referring to fig. 2 and 3, in an embodiment of the present invention, a round PIN 5 splicing clamping fixture includes a base 1, a clamping table 2 and a positioning member 3 installed in the clamping table 2, the clamping table 2 is fixed above the base 1, and the clamping table 2 is fixedly connected to the base 1 through a screw.
The positioning piece 3 is of a cylindrical structure, the positioning piece 3 comprises a front clamping block 301 and a rear clamping block 302, the front clamping block 301 and the rear clamping block 302 are identical in structure and are symmetrically arranged, the front clamping block 301 is provided with an inwards concave first accommodating groove 301-1, the first accommodating groove 301-1 penetrates through the upper end face and the lower end face of the front clamping block 301, the rear clamping block 302 is provided with a second accommodating groove matched with the first accommodating groove 301-1 in position, a material placing hole formed after the first accommodating groove 301-1 and the second accommodating groove are attached to each other is matched with the appearance structure of the round PIN needle 5, when the round PIN needle 5 is installed, the round PIN needle 5 is only required to be clamped between the front clamping block 301 and the rear clamping block 302, namely in the material placing hole, and then the whole positioning piece 3 is placed in the clamping table 2 for locking and clamping.
